PROCUREMENT OVERVIEW
The Defense Logistics Agency (DLA) is seeking to procure cushioning pads as part of its logistics and supply chain operations. The core objective is to fulfill the Department of Defense's requirements for high-quality cushioning products that meet specific performance standards. This procurement is essential for ensuring the safety and protection of military equipment during transport and storage.
ISSUING ORGANIZATION
The issuing organization is the Department of Defense, specifically the Defense Logistics Agency, located in Columbus, Ohio, USA. For inquiries regarding the solicitation, bidders should contact the buyer listed in block 5 of the solicitation document. If further assistance is needed, bidders can reach out via email at [email protected].
